Connect to data in an application

 When connecting to data in an application, you would begin in the same way as you would when connecting to the other data sources: by selecting the Get data feature in Power BI Desktop. Then, select the option that you need from the Online Services category. In this example, you select SharePoint Online List.

After you've selected Connect, you'll be asked for your SharePoint URL. This URL is the one that you use to sign into your SharePoint site through a web browser. You can copy the URL from your SharePoint site and paste it into the connection window in Power BI. You don't need to enter your full URL file path; you only need to load your site URL because, when you're connected, you can select the specific list that you want to load. Depending on the URL that you copied, you might need to delete the last part of your URL.

After you've entered your URL, select OK. Power BI needs to authorize the connection to SharePoint, so sign in with your Microsoft account and then select Connect.
